## Tuning

Squintbot's scanner trades recall for speed. Raising the edit-distance threshold catches more squatted names but floods the review queue; support should expect ticket volume to track that knob closely. Lower the concurrency cap if the Nettleford registry mirror starts throttling us. All knobs live in `scanner.toml`; the shipped defaults, which suit most deployments, are given below.

constants for fajop-tahaf:
RATE_LIMITS = {
    "holael": 2,
    "oliael": 10,
    "druael": 10,
    "wenwyn": 10,
}

Ticket #— Floor 9 Opening Prep, Brindlemoor House

Hi facilities folks, Floor 9 opens to staff next Monday and we need a few things squared away before then. Lift access is live, but the two side doors by the kitchenette are still on the old lock config — please reprogram them before Friday. Also, signage for the quiet rooms hasn't arrived, so pop up the temporary printed ones for now. Until the badge readers sync, the interim door code for Floor 9 is below.

door code, bajop-bajog: bdg-DSWAC-43621

- [ ] Step 7: Archive cold storage buckets (Glacierline tier). Confirm both ceremony witnesses are present, verify bucket manifests match the Oxbow ledger, then seal the archive key shares. Plugin authors may observe but not handle shares. Once sealed, the archive index itself is encrypted and can only be reopened with the passphrase below.

vault phrase of badup-hahig = tamael-aldael-kelmir-istael-fenok-istwyn-tamius-jorath-oliion

Effective next quarter, the Veldane Group marketing budget is reduced by 18%. Sponsorships end. Print campaigns end. Digital spend consolidated under the Harrowgate office. Regional discretionary funds frozen pending review. Headcount unaffected for now; agency retainers under renegotiation. Rationale: margin pressure in the Orevale product line and the failed Lumastra launch. Board approval obtained last week; no further sign-off required. Managers must not share figures outside this group. The cut directly supports the following.

board note of hafog-kafop: Only 50 of the 505 pilot accounts renewed Eliys, so a churn review is set for April 7. Fravanox Partners is in early talks to buy Tamvanix Logistics for about $273.9 million.